MACKDADDY 2008-09 Fall/Winter Collection
by L.A. Ruano, September 7, 2008

Japanese label MACKDADDY, known for their strong use of colors and retro design continue executing both cleverly within their new 2008-09 fall/winter collection. The lineup combines different looks without settling on a certain style or overbearing any piece with excess detailing. Consisting of denim, tees, outerwear and accessories, MACKDADDY offers a wide range of everyday items with top notch quality. Various pieces from the collection are now available at ZOZOTOWN.
